QMCDecode:终极指南 - 在macOS上轻松解锁QQ音乐加密音频
2026/7/2 13:48:27 网站建设 项目流程

QMCDecode:终极指南 - 在macOS上轻松解锁QQ音乐加密音频

【免费下载链接】QMCDecodeQQ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录,默认转换结果存储到~/Music/QMCConvertOutput,可自定义需要转换的文件和输出路径项目地址: https://gitcode.com/gh_mirrors/qm/QMCDecode

你是否曾遇到过这样的困扰?在QQ音乐上精心收藏的音乐,下载后却只能在官方客户端播放,无法在其他播放器或设备上使用。当你想要在车载音响上播放、导入到专业音频软件中编辑,或者只是简单地想在iTunes中整理时,那些加密的.qmcflac、.qmc3等文件就像上了锁的宝箱,看得见却用不了。

QMCDecode正是为你解决这一痛点的专业macOS工具。它通过逆向工程破解了QQ音乐的加密算法,让你能够将13种QQ音乐加密格式转换为标准音频文件,真正拥有你下载的音乐内容。

三大核心优势:为什么选择QMCDecode?

1. 格式全覆盖,一网打尽所有QQ音乐加密格式

无论你下载的是高品质无损音乐还是普通音质文件,QMCDecode都能完美支持:

  • 无损格式转换:.qmcflac、.mflac、.mflac0、.bkcflac → .flac
  • 高品质MP3转换:.qmc0、.qmc3、.bkcmp3 → .mp3
  • 流媒体格式转换:.qmc2、.mgg、.mgg1、.qmcogg → .ogg

这意味着无论你下载了什么类型的QQ音乐文件,都能找到对应的转换方案,音质无损保留。

2. 智能识别,自动定位QQ音乐下载目录

QMCDecode的智能之处在于它能够自动扫描并识别QQ音乐的默认下载位置:

~/Library/Containers/com.tencent.QQMusicMac/Data/Library/Application Support/QQMusicMac/iQmc/

启动应用后,该目录下的所有加密文件会自动显示在文件列表中,无需你手动查找和添加。这种无缝体验让你专注于音乐本身,而不是繁琐的文件管理。

3. 简单三步,小白也能轻松上手

复杂的音频转换工具往往让普通用户望而却步,但QMCDecode将整个过程简化为三个直观步骤:

  1. 选择文件:自动加载QQ音乐目录,或手动选择需要转换的文件
  2. 设置输出:默认保存到~/Music/QMCConvertOutput/,也可自定义路径
  3. 开始转换:一键点击,批量处理多个文件

四大实用场景:解决你的真实音乐需求

场景一:车载音乐自由播放

痛点:下载的QQ音乐无法在车载音响上播放,长途驾驶时只能听广播或U盘里的老歌。

解决方案:使用QMCDecode将所有加密文件转换为MP3格式,复制到U盘或SD卡,插入车载音响即可畅享。转换100首歌曲仅需3-5分钟,CPU占用率仅30-40%,不影响电脑正常使用。

场景二:专业音频制作素材准备

痛点:音频制作人员需要QQ音乐中的素材进行视频配乐或混音,但专业软件无法识别加密格式。

解决方案:将.qmcflac文件无损转换为.flac格式,导入到Audacity、Adobe Audition等专业软件中。转换过程保持原始音频数据完整性,频谱分析显示无音质损失,确保后期处理的最佳质量。

场景三:跨平台音乐库迁移

痛点:购买了QQ音乐会员,下载了大量高品质音乐,但想在Windows、Linux或其他播放器中播放。

解决方案:批量转换所有文件为标准格式,按专辑、艺术家分类存储。无论是iTunes、Foobar2000还是VLC播放器,都能完美兼容,真正实现音乐自由。

场景四:长期音乐收藏与备份

痛点:担心QQ音乐服务变更或会员到期后无法访问已下载的音乐。

解决方案:使用QMCDecode将所有加密文件转换为标准格式,创建永久音乐收藏库。建议的目录结构:

~/Music/QMCConvertOutput/ ├── FLAC无损/ ├── MP3高品质/ ├── 车载音乐/ └── 临时转换/

快速上手:5分钟完成首次转换

环境准备

  • macOS 10.13或更高版本
  • Xcode 13.0或更高版本(仅编译需要)
  • 约50MB可用磁盘空间

安装步骤

  1. 获取源代码

    git clone https://gitcode.com/gh_mirrors/qm/QMCDecode cd QMCDecode
  2. 编译应用程序

    • 使用Xcode打开项目:open QMCDecode.xcodeproj
    • 选择Product → Build(或按⌘B)进行编译
    • 编译成功后选择Product → Run(或按⌘R)启动应用
  3. 首次使用配置

    • 工具会自动请求访问QQ音乐下载目录的权限
    • 默认输出目录为~/Music/QMCConvertOutput
    • 如需自定义输出路径,可在界面中设置

QMCDecode用户界面展示:左侧显示QQ音乐下载的加密文件列表,右侧设置输出路径,一键开始转换

技术揭秘:QMCDecode如何工作?

加密格式识别机制

QMCDecode通过双重验证机制智能识别加密格式:

  1. 扩展名匹配:扫描13种已知的QQ音乐加密格式扩展名
  2. 头部验证:读取文件前128字节,验证加密标记和文件完整性
  3. 版本检测:根据扩展名判断使用v1或v2解密算法

密钥解析与解密过程

解密的核心在于密钥提取和派生,QMCDecode采用以下流程:

  1. 密钥提取:从文件头部提取Base64编码的原始密钥
  2. 解码处理:解码Base64得到二进制密钥数据
  3. 密钥派生:使用特定种子生成简单密钥
  4. TEA算法解密:组合生成16字节TEA算法密钥,解密剩余数据块

双引擎架构确保稳定性

QMCDecode采用模块化设计,QMCKeyDecoder负责密钥解析,TeaCipher实现TEA算法数据解密。这种分离式架构不仅提高了代码的可维护性,还确保了转换过程的稳定性和效率。

常见问题与解决方案

转换失败的可能原因及解决方法

  1. 文件损坏:下载过程中文件不完整

    • 解决方案:重新下载源文件
  2. 权限问题:无法访问输入或输出目录

    • 解决方案:检查目录权限,确保有读写权限
  3. 不支持的格式:QQ音乐更新了加密算法

    • 解决方案:等待工具更新或提交Issue

转换后音频问题处理

  1. 音质下降:确保选择正确的输出格式

    • .qmcflac应转换为.flac而非.mp3以保持无损音质
  2. 元数据丢失:使用kid3工具修复ID3标签

    # 安装kid3 brew install kid3 # 批量修复标签 kid3-cli -c "set album '专辑名称'" *.mp3
  3. 播放器不识别:检查文件扩展名是否正确

    • 确保.flac文件确实为FLAC格式而非误标记

性能优化与最佳实践

批量处理策略

对于大量文件转换,建议采用以下策略提升效率:

  1. 按格式分组处理:先处理所有.flac格式,再处理.mp3格式
  2. 大小文件分开:小文件(<10MB)可以批量并行处理,大文件(>50MB)单独处理
  3. 输出目录管理:按专辑、艺术家或年份创建子目录,便于后续管理

系统资源优化

  1. 存储优化:使用SSD存储显著提高读写速度
  2. 分批处理:超过500个文件时建议分批处理,每批100-200个
  3. 避免冲突:转换时避免运行Xcode、Final Cut Pro等资源密集型应用

未来展望:QMCDecode的发展方向

功能增强计划

  1. 更多格式支持:随着QQ音乐更新,持续添加新格式支持
  2. 跨平台扩展:考虑开发Windows和Linux版本,服务更多用户
  3. 图形界面优化:添加更多高级选项和批量操作功能

社区驱动发展

QMCDecode采用MIT开源协议,鼓励社区贡献:

  • 问题反馈:在项目仓库提交Issue报告bug
  • 功能建议:提出新功能需求或改进建议
  • 代码贡献:提交Pull Request添加新格式支持或优化算法

开始你的音乐自由之旅

QMCDecode不仅仅是一个格式转换工具,它代表了你对数字内容自主权的追求。通过这个工具,你可以:

  • 真正拥有自己购买或下载的音乐
  • 自由选择播放设备和软件
  • 长期保存珍贵的音乐收藏
  • 跨平台使用不受服务商限制

QMCDecode应用图标:鲜明的橙色设计,突出工具的解密功能,便于在macOS系统中快速识别

无论你是普通音乐爱好者想要在车载音响上播放QQ音乐,还是专业音频工作者需要处理加密素材,QMCDecode都提供了简单有效的解决方案。其开源特性确保了工具的透明度和可持续性,社区驱动的开发模式保证了它能跟上QQ音乐的更新步伐。

现在就开始你的音乐解密之旅吧!下载QMCDecode,让每一首你喜爱的歌曲都能在任何设备上自由播放,重新掌控你的数字音乐世界。

【免费下载链接】QMCDecodeQQ音乐QMC格式转换为普通格式(qmcflac转flac,qmc0,qmc3转mp3, mflac,mflac0等转flac),仅支持macOS,可自动识别到QQ音乐下载目录,默认转换结果存储到~/Music/QMCConvertOutput,可自定义需要转换的文件和输出路径项目地址: https://gitcode.com/gh_mirrors/qm/QMCDecode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询